All-angle behavior in two-body scattering and phenomenological hard strings

All-angle behavior of the cross sections in two-body scattering is examined by a counting law on the basis of the string structure in a hadron. Then the fixed-angle scaling is interpreted as the contribution of strings at large momentum transfer. This counting law contains a good crossing relation, and predicts the energy dependence and the angular distribution of the cross sections in various processes. In charge-exchange processes the applicability of this model to all-angle cross sections is examined. This model gives a good explanation of the large ratio (dsigma( pp)/dt)/(dsigma( p-barp)/dt), the asymmetric distribution of dsigma(K/sup -/p ..-->.. ..pi../sup +/..sigma../sup -/)/dt, and the transition behavior between the fixed-angle scaling and the Regge-pole-like behavior.
